My Kid Review
The Boogie Barn Band comes with a QR Code that directs readers to an audio recording of a song and an introduction to the characters in the book. I found the recording to be a delightful addition to the book. I’m not sure if children reading the book will have access to QR Code readers, but I suppose it is possible. They may even miss the QR Code as it looks like a ticket. The song does give children the opportunity to participate in the story. Nephew and Neal chose to write the story like lyrics to a song.
The cartoon-like illustrations by Makartichan will appeal to most children. They complement the text well.
The Boogie Barn Band could be used as a fun tie-in to a music lesson at the elementary level. It would be an appropriate addition to a K-12 Christian school library.
